Finnlines welcomes second hybrid Ro-Ro in series

Photo: Finnlines

Finnlines took delivery of a new hybrid Ro-Ro vessel from China Merchants Jinling Shipyard (Jiangsu) on Monday, May 30.

Finneco II is the second in a series of three ships ordered from the same builder. All three vessels will sail under the Finnish flag and will enter Finnlines’ Baltic sea, North Sea, and Biscay traffic.

The ship is 238 metres long and has a cargo capacity of 5,800 lane metres. The vessel can carry 400 trailers per voyage, denoting a nearly 40 per cent increase in cargo-carrying capacity compared to the next largest vessels in the Finnlines fleet.
